Would-Be Home Invasion Suspects Caught On Video

COVINA (CNS) - Police today were investigating an attempted home invasion robbery in Covina. 

Two men, both wearing hoodies and with bandanas covering their faces, approached a home in the 1500 block of East Algrove Street about 9:15 p.m. Tuesday, according to the Covina Police Department.

``One of the men was armed with a chrome revolver while the other held brass knuckles in his right fist and a tire iron in his left hand,'' according to a police statement. 

``The men knocked on the door and were captured by a video doorbell. The resident inside saw the armed men and called the police. The men continued knocking for approximately a minute before fleeing to a white panel van.''Police said the van was last seen heading east toward Starglen Drive.
